Fire kills mother, 2 children in Bauchi village


A woman and two of her children have been burnt to death as a result of an inferno that occurred at Riban Garmu village, Dewu ward in Kirfi local government of Bauchi state Wednesday night.


A member representing Kirfi local government in the Bauchi state house of assembly Honourable Abdulkadir Umar Dewu disclosed this to newsmen after he paid a sympathy visit to the family of the victims.


The lawmaker said it was pathetic to see a mother and her two biological children consumed by fire.


Dewu urged the families of the victims to take the incident as an act of God and prayed that such calamity would not recur in future.


He presented a donation of N250,000 to the victims’ families donated by the state governor Bala Mohammed.


“The loss suffered by the families and the community is painful and irreparable loss because no amount of money can pay the price of a mother and her two children that were burnt in the inferno”. He said.


He also extended governor Bala Mohammed’s condolences to the families of the deceased advising the communityagainst using fire indiscriminately to avoid disaster.


An eyewitness account said the fire was as a result of electrical fault adding that it happened in the night when people were sleeping and the fire burnt the four bedroom house completely.


He regretted that when the fire started, there was effort by neighbours to burgle the door of the room to rescue the woman and her children but it was abortive as the fire escalated thereby killing them.
